Study: Single-cell RNA sequencing of the CFS414 zebra finch cell line
show Abstracthide Abstract
The zebra finch is one of the most commonly studied songbirds in biology, particularly in genomics, neuroscience and vocal communication. However, this species lacks a robust cell line for molecular biology research and reagent optimization. We generated a cell line from zebra finch embryonic fibroblasts using the SV40 large and small T antigens, designated CFS414. This cell line demonstrates an improvement over previous songbird cell lines through continuous and density-independent growth, allowing for indefinite culture and monoclonal line derivation. Cytogenetic, genomic, and transcriptomic profiling established the provenance of this cell line and identified the expression of genes relevant to ongoing songbird research. This single-cell RNA sequencing experiment provided information on the gene expression landscape of the cell line, informing on its cell type, transcriptomic stability, and value to researchers utilizing the zebra finch as a model organism. Overall design: 2 Samples at separate passage timepoints

Construction protocol: Confluent CFS414 cells were dissociated from the surface of the dish using 0.25% Trypsin-EDTA, washed with PBS three times and counted on a Countess II FL (Life Technologies). A single cell suspension was diluted to around 1,000 cells/µL in 1xPBS. Approximately 5,000 cells were run on a Chromium Chip (10x Genomics). cDNA synthesis and library preparation was performed using the Chromium Single Cell 3' Reagent Kits (version 3, 10x Genomics) according to manufacturer's instructions. Sequencing was performed by Novogene Co., Ltd. on an Illumina HiSeq 4000.
